spelling test
| Term | Definition |
|---|---|
| Girth | Circumference |
| Treason | the betrayal of one's country ; especially by aiding an enemy |
| Indentured | contract binding one person into the service of another for a specified; amount of time and/or labor rendered |
| Credible | believable, trustworthy, reliable |
| Rabid | extremely violent, (as if) affected by rabies |
| Jostling | pushing and shoving |
| Facade | the front or face of a building; a surface appearance (as opposed to what may be behind it) |
| Impersonate | to imitate the character or appearance of someone |
| Noble | upper class person in the kingdom; high status |
| Diplomacy | tact and skill in dealing with people |
| Fraud | to cheat or swindle; a deception |
| Swindler | a person who cheats or defrauds other people out of money/property |
| Inevitable | incapable of being avoided or prevented |
| Lunacy | insanity |
| Entourage | a group of attendants or associates |
